519. Animal Communication: How to Connect with Your Pets

Animals are such an important part of our emotional, mental, and physical health. They seem to understand our emotions – sometimes even more than we do. And if they can sense our emotions, it shouldn’t surprise us to find out that we can communicate with them on an even deeper level. Miranda Alcott is an animal and human communications counselor and she’s dedicated her life to facilitating greater understanding between animals and those that care for them. As children, we communicate intuitively with animals. So as adults working on healing our inner child, it’s important that we learn to get back in touch with that aspect of ourselves. Miranda dives into topics such as supporting our animals as their lives change alongside our own, how to listen harmoniously, and the lessons we can learn from our animals.
